Package com.onec.mail.dispatch
Class SmtpMailDispatcher
java.lang.Object
com.onec.mail.dispatch.SmtpMailDispatcher
- All Implemented Interfaces:
MailDispatcher
-
Constructor Summary
ConstructorsConstructorDescriptionSmtpMailDispatcher(org.springframework.mail.javamail.JavaMailSender sender, MailProperties properties) -
Method Summary
Modifier and TypeMethodDescriptionvoiddispatch(MailMessage message) Synchronously deliver a message to the provider.name()Stable provider id, e.g.
-
Constructor Details
-
SmtpMailDispatcher
public SmtpMailDispatcher(org.springframework.mail.javamail.JavaMailSender sender, MailProperties properties)
-
-
Method Details
-
name
Description copied from interface:MailDispatcherStable provider id, e.g. "smtp", "sendgrid", "ses".- Specified by:
namein interfaceMailDispatcher
-
dispatch
Description copied from interface:MailDispatcherSynchronously deliver a message to the provider. ThrowsMailDeliveryExceptionon failure.- Specified by:
dispatchin interfaceMailDispatcher
-